The first season of Dexter premiered on October 1, 2006, and introduced viewers to the main character, Dexter Morgan (played by Michael C. Hall), a brilliant and socially awkward forensic analyst working for the Miami-Dade Police Department. Unbeknownst to his colleagues, Dexter has a dark secret: he is a serial killer who only targets individuals who have escaped justice. The season follows Dexter as he navigates his complicated relationships with his sister, Debra (played by Jennifer Carpenter), and his father, Harry (played by James Remar), who is aware of Dexter's condition and helps him control his impulses.
